The actual number of Kyrgyzstan gambling halls is a fact in some dispute. As data from this state, out in the very remote interior area of Central Asia, often is hard to acquire, this may not be all that bizarre. Whether there are 2 or 3 approved casinos is the element at issue, perhaps not in reality the most consequential slice of information that we do not have.
What no doubt will be correct, as it is of the majority of the ex-USSR states, and certainly true of those in Asia, is that there certainly is a good many more not approved and backdoor gambling dens. The adjustment to legalized betting didn’t energize all the illegal places to come out of the dark into the light. So, the battle regarding the total number of Kyrgyzstan’s casinos is a small one at most: how many authorized ones is the element we are trying to answer here.
We understand that in Bishkek, the capital metropolis, there is the Casino Las Vegas (a marvelously unique name, don’t you think?), which has both gaming tables and slot machine games. We can additionally find both the Casino Bishkek and the Xanadu Casino. Each of these have 26 video slots and 11 table games, split amongst roulette, chemin de fer, and poker. Given the amazing similarity in the size and layout of these two Kyrgyzstan gambling halls, it may be even more bizarre to see that they share an location. This appears most unlikely, so we can clearly determine that the list of Kyrgyzstan’s gambling halls, at least the authorized ones, ends at 2 members, one of them having changed their title recently.
